N-point Discrete Fourier Transform WebThe DFT has a very important property known as linearity. This property states that the DFT of the sum of two signals is equal to the sum of the transforms of each signal; that is, if an input sequence x1 (n) has a DFT X1 (m) and another input sequence x2 (n) has a DFT X2 (m), then the DFT of the sum of these sequences xsum (n) = x1 (n) + x2 (n ...

The Discrete Fourier Transform is a numerical variant of the Fourier Transform. Specifically, given a vector of n input amplitudes such as {f 0, f 1, f 2, ... , f n-2, f n-1 }, the Discrete Fourier Transform yields a set of n frequency magnitudes. WebMay 23, 2024 · The Fourier transform of the discrete-time signal s (n) is defined to be. S ( e i 2 π f) = ∑ n = − ∞ ∞ s ( n) e − ( i 2 π f n) Frequency here has no units. As should be expected, this definition is linear, with the transform of a sum of signals equaling the sum of their transforms. Real-valued signals have conjugate-symmetric spectra:
